Replacing a roof in South Kent, CT involves several key considerations that influence the overall project scope and cost. Understanding typical factors can help property owners plan effectively and compare options for their TPO roof replacement projects.
- Materials: TPO roofing membranes are commonly used for flat or low-slope roofs, offering durability and energy efficiency suitable for South Kent’s climate.
- Size and Scope: The project size varies based on the roof’s square footage and complexity, impacting overall project duration and materials needed.
- Labor Complexity: The installation process for TPO roofs requires careful seam welding and precise fitting, which can influence labor costs depending on roof design.
- Permitting: Local building permits are typically required for roof replacements in South Kent, CT, ensuring compliance with municipal codes.
- Additional Features: Optional upgrades such as insulation, flashing, or membrane accessories may add to the project scope and cost.
